Nokia Oyj (HLSE:NOKIA) Could Be 46% Undervalued On Its AI RAN Push

Nokia Oyj (HLSE:NOKIA) has drawn fresh investor attention after unveiling its industry first commercial AI RAN platform, a shift toward AI powered, software defined radio networks that sits alongside new AI focused customer agreements.

The new AI-RAN launch and recent 5G agreements come at a time when Nokia Oyj’s share price has fallen 27.81% over the past month and 11.36% over 90 days, yet the year to date share price return of 48.84% and very large 1 year total shareholder return of 128.13% suggest longer term momentum has still been strong, even as near term sentiment cools on mixed earnings and guidance.

The most followed narrative on Nokia Oyj values the stock at €15.16 per share versus the last close of €8.22. This creates a wide gap that hinges on how investors view earnings, margins, and the AI push.

Nokia delivered a strong second quarter, reporting revenue of €4.815 billion and earnings per share of €0.07, supported by growing demand for AI and cloud-related solutions. The company is also expanding its presence in the defense sector through AI-powered tools for 5G networks, creating additional opportunities to diversify revenue and strengthen long-term growth prospects.
